Skip to content
/ bin Public

The contents of my bin dir. Eventually expand to some kind of Ansibile or Puppet to re-constitute my desktop when I crash, burn, corrupt, despoil, savage, or ravage my system.

Notifications You must be signed in to change notification settings

ahoffer/bin

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

# bin
The contents of my bin dir. Useful when I crash, burn, corrupt, despoil, savage, or ravage my system. 


## Notes

* fresh-start is the big script that install almost everything

1. Run install-pkcs11
1. Download DoD certs and run install-os-dodcerts
1. Run setup-nssdb
1. Run install-nssdb-dodcerts


## bashrc
Read the comments in bashrc. 


## On a new machine...
- Generate an ssh kepair with ssh-keygen -b 2048 -t rsa
- Copy pub key to GitHub account
- Clone from home dir, git clone git@github.com:ahoffer/bin.git

After cloning...
- Copy gitconfig_template to ~/.gitconfig
- Open ~/bin/bashrc. Copy the parts that add ~/bin to the path into ~/.bashrc and source .bashrc
- Source ~/.bashrc
- Set up secret env var in ~/.bashrc

About

The contents of my bin dir. Eventually expand to some kind of Ansibile or Puppet to re-constitute my desktop when I crash, burn, corrupt, despoil, savage, or ravage my system.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published